Fireweed

ahd-5
  • noun. Any of various plants of the genus Epilobium, especially E. angustifolium (syn. Chamerion angustifolium), having long, terminal, spikelike clusters of pinkish-purple flowers.
  • noun. Any of several weedy North American plants of the genus Erechtites in the composite family, having small white or greenish flowers grouped in discoid heads.
  • The Century Dictionary and Cyclopedia
  • noun. In botany: The Erechthites hieracifolia, a coarse annual composite of North America, so called from its appearing abundantly where clearings have recently been burned over.
  • noun. The great willow-herb, Epilobium angustifolium, for the same reason.
  • noun. The horseweed, Erigeron Canadensis.
  • noun. A species of plantain, Plantago media.
  • noun. The jimson-weed, Datura Stramonium; also, occasionally, D. Tatula.
  • noun. The wild lettuce, Lactuca Canadensis.
  • noun. The golden ragwort, Senecio aureus.
